The Mechanics of 4 Easy Steps To Revive Your Ride: How To Instantly Shine Up Faded Vehicle Headlights
Reviving faded headlights involves a simple, multi-step process that requires minimal expertise and specialized tools. The process typically starts with cleaning the headlights, followed by applying a specialized restoration solution to remove old coatings and imperfections.
Step 1: Clean the Headlights
The first step in reviving faded headlights is to clean the surface using a mild soap solution and a soft-bristled brush. This helps remove dirt, grime, and old coatings that can hinder the restoration process.
Step 2: Apply a Restoration Solution
Once the headlights are clean, apply a specialized restoration solution to the affected areas. This solution helps break down old coatings and imperfections, allowing for a smooth and even application of the new coating.
Step 3: Apply a Protective Coating
After applying the restoration solution, use a soft cloth to apply a protective coating to the headlight surface. This coating helps prevent fading and damage, ensuring the headlights remain clear and functional for an extended period.
Step 4: Finish with a Clear Coat
The final step involves applying a clear coat to the headlight surface. This clear coat helps protect the new coating and prevent it from fading or becoming discolored.
